I recently had my Coolant Temp Fan light come on my 85 Sedan De Ville, (it did not stay on). I checked the coolant levels, they are fine. I let the car run to see if the fans come on, they do. When I shut the car off, the coolant bubbled a bit and the level rose in the overflow tank, but not a lot. My other question was the service engine soon light flickered on the same day. i recently picked this car up, it seems to run great, Very low miles (64k), in great shape also. Anybody have any suggestions on what I can look for or do next? Change the coolant out? Put in a toggle switch for the fans? I'm not a mechanic, just trying to keep my means of transportation on the road without paying mechanic bills. Welcome to AF. Many things can cause this, bad thermostat, bad radiator cap, partially clogged radiator, keep in mind the HT4100 was a troublesome engine from day one. Assume you mean coolant temp lite there is no fan lite as you stated. There is a way to do self diagnostcs thru the ac control head to see if there are any codes. 25year old car here, was the coolant ever flushed, any service records?
